About you

As a Senior Solution Consultant, you will own the successful specification and configuration of Clue to meet customer requirements through best\-practice implementations, guided by a structured onboarding process.

The role combines technical, commercial and domain expertise with management skills to understand customer requirements and ensure all elements of a proposed solution are fully understood, appropriately defined, commercially viable, and supported by clear plans for successful delivery.

You will own, define, document and support the delivery of the Clue solution across the customer lifecycle, from prospect through initial implementation and onward to maturing and expanding the customer. You will work with the customer and Clue colleagues from across the business to ensure that requirements are clearly and unambiguously understood by all parties and to ensure that what is proposed and sold to our customers is deliverable and meets the customer’s functional and non\-functional needs, including both initial sales and any material expansions.

You will provide external and internal design authority services for complex solutions, advocating for our customers in arbitrating trade\-offs across Product, Technology, and Professional Services to keep the solution aligned with our contractual commitments.

Key Accountabilities

  • Own and maintain the solution blueprint
Establish and maintain a clear, current “solution blueprint” (e.g., outline solution design / solution definition) covering:

Committed scope and outcomes

Assumptions, dependencies, constraints, and non\-functional requirements

Integration boundaries and responsibilities

Acceptance criteria (at the appropriate level)

Ensure the blueprint remains the single reference for “what the solution for a customer is, and why”.

  • Protect solution integrity through delivery
Remain accountable for the end\-to\-end integrity of the solution across delivery phases.

Ensure delivery activities remain aligned with what was sold and committed.

Identify and surface misalignment early (scope drift, feasibility issues, dependency gaps).

Drive resolution of “solution correctness” issues (not delivery execution).

  • Govern change requests and solution trade\-offs
Own (or co\-own) governance of material change requests impacting solution integrity:

Clarify the change, impacts, and options

Support commercial/contractual alignment where needed

Arbitrate trade\-offs across Product / Tech / Professional Services when there are competing constraints (time, cost, scope, risk).

Ensure change decisions and outcomes are documented and traceable.

  • Cross\-functional solution leadership
Act as the primary cross\-functional point for “is this the right solution / is this still the right solution?” decisions.

Provide clarity on roles and ownership boundaries (Project Manager owns delivery execution; Solution Owner owns solution alignment).

Facilitate decision\-making where ambiguity would otherwise stall delivery or increase risk.

  • Outcomes and stabilisation
Confirm that the solution is producing the intended outcomes after go\-live.

Resolve structural solution issues that prevent value realisation.

Finalise and document handover to Customer Success and Support for BAU ownership.

  • Codify learnings into best practice
Capture and codify reusable patterns, templates, and lessons learned (“make non\-standard standard”).

Capture and feedback improvements to ways of working
